Cymbidium eburneum

A classic cool-growing species producing arching spikes of large, pure white flowers with a yellow-marked lip. Renowned for its elegance and strong, sweet fragrance. Flowers are long-lasting and often used in hybrid breeding.
Care
- Light: Bright filtered light, similar to other cool-growing Cymbidiums.
- Water: Water regularly during active growth, keeping the mix just moist; reduce slightly in winter.
- Temperature: Cool to intermediate (5–25 °C); tolerates light frost when established.
- Media: Free-draining Cymbidium mix in deep pots to accommodate strong root growth.
- Fertiliser: Regular feeding with balanced fertiliser in spring/summer, switching to bloom booster in autumn to encourage spikes.
Key Characteristics
- Flower Size: Large (up to 10 cm)
- Colour: Pure white with yellow throat
- Spike Habit: Graceful arching spikes
- Blooming Season: Late winter to early spring (Aug–Sept)
- Fragrance: Strong, sweet
- Plant Size: Medium to large, clumping habit
